Another important event for the sector has been the change in electricity tariffs in Russia. Since July 1, 2025, a planned price indexation for households and businesses has been conducted: average electricity and utility tariffs increased by 11–12% nationwide. This annual increase, mandated by the government, is intended to help energy companies offset inflationary costs and invest in maintaining infrastructure....

In Asia, financial hubs such as Hong Kong and Singapore are competing for the title of leading crypto hub, offering specialized regulatory regimes and tax incentives for blockchain businesses. In the Gulf countries (UAE, Bahrain, Saudi Arabia), authorities are also implementing initiatives to attract cryptocurrency companies and develop the Web3 sector.
